Introduction to the Pomeron
J. Kwiecinski
Abstract
Elements of the pomeron phenomenology within the Regge pole exchange picture are recalled. This includes discussion of the high energy behaviour of total cross-sections, the triple pomeron limit of the diffractive dissociation and the single particle distributions in the central region. The BFKL pomeron and QCD expectations for the small x behaviour of the deep inelastic scattering structure functions are discussed. The dedicated measurements of the hadronic final state in deep inelastic scattering at small x probing the QCD pomeron are described. The deep inelastic diffraction is also discussed.
